Subject: Key rotation for the Mintgrove points ledger

Hey folks — quick heads up for whoever inherits this. We're rotating the Mintgrove loyalty-points ledger key this Friday, since the old one dates back to the Tallowfield migration. The ledger writer, reconciliation jobs, and the nightly audit sweep all need updating. The new key for the ledger service is right below.

service key, yadug-bajog: zpat3_pou

Key vars: `POOL_MIN` (default 5), `POOL_MAX` (default 40), `POOL_IDLE_MS` (default 30000). Support: if customers report timeouts, check `POOL_MAX` before escalating. Do not raise it past 80 without approval. The pooler also requires an auth credential to register with the cluster coordinator. Missing credential = pooler boots but accepts zero connections, which looks like a total outage. It is set per environment, never shared. Add this line to the env file to register the pooler.

vault entry, yahif-yajep: COURIER_KEY29=b802bdf8034096b65a51c6ba5abe2

Welcome to the tracing corner of the Fennhollow platform. Every request entering the Gatefold API gets a trace ID that follows it through billing, inventory, and the Pinwheel notification service. If a span looks orphaned, it usually means someone forgot to propagate headers in an async call — check the worker first. Dashboards live under the Tracing tab in Lanternview; the weekly sync is a good place to flag gaps. To open the trace archive's recovery store, enter the passphrase below.

recovery phrase for bajef-yagag: zordor-casok-tammir

Ticket: Harrowgate transcoding farm workers idle since last night's rollout. Root cause: the worker env file in the Veldmoor cluster was copied from the sandbox template, so workers register against the sandbox queue and never receive production jobs. Backlog is roughly six hours of footage for the Pellford launch. Please hold the release until the farm drains. Fix is to restore the production queue settings and credentials; the corrected env file needs the following line appended.

secret setting of yajog-taguf: ARCHIVE_KEY3=051